Design of Victoria's Wedding Dress
Victoria's wedding dress is a masterpiece of gothic elegance, combining traditional Victorian elements with a haunting twist. Designed by Tim Burton and his team, the gown reflects the character's personality while fitting seamlessly into the film's dark aesthetic.
The dress features:
- A corseted bodice with delicate lace detailing
- A full skirt adorned with intricate embroidery
- Long sleeves that add to the formal elegance
- Shades of white and gray, symbolizing purity and death

Historical Context
To understand the significance of Victoria's wedding dress, it's essential to examine its historical context. During the Victorian era, wedding attire was a reflection of social status and personal taste. The elaborate designs and luxurious materials used in these garments were meant to showcase wealth and sophistication.
Tim Burton's team drew from this rich history, incorporating elements that would resonate with both period enthusiasts and modern audiences. By blending historical accuracy with creative flair, they created a gown that stands out as a masterpiece of animated fashion.
